insuring art is a crucial aspect of protecting your valuable assets. Art insurance policies provide coverage for unexpected events such as theft, damage, or loss due to natural disasters. Just like any other valuable possession, art pieces are susceptible to risks that can result in financial loss. Without proper insurance, art owners may have to bear the full cost of restoring or replacing their precious artworks in case of any unfortunate incidents.

One of the key benefits of insuring art is peace of mind. Knowing that your art collection is protected gives you the assurance that you will not suffer a substantial financial setback in case of a mishap. Whether your art pieces are displayed in your home, loaned to a museum, or stored in a secure facility, having the right insurance coverage in place ensures that you are financially protected against unforeseen circumstances.

Another advantage of insuring art is the flexibility it offers in tailoring a policy to suit your specific needs. Art insurance policies can be customized based on the type of art you own, its value, and where it is being kept or displayed. Whether you have a diverse collection of paintings, sculptures, antiques, or rare artifacts, there are specialized insurance plans available to cover each type of artwork adequately.

In addition to financial protection, art insurance can also provide access to expert advice and assistance in case of a claim. Many insurance providers work with art appraisers, restorers, and other specialists to evaluate the extent of damage to an artwork and recommend the best course of action to minimize any loss. This professional support can be invaluable in ensuring that your art pieces are properly restored or replaced in the event of a claim.

When considering art insurance, it is essential to work with a reputable insurance provider that specializes in insuring art. Art insurance policies are often complex and require a thorough understanding of the art market, appraisal methods, and restoration techniques. By choosing a knowledgeable insurance provider who has experience in insuring art collections, you can be confident that your policy will provide comprehensive coverage tailored to your specific needs.
